A range of roulettes with live dealers and Specialist hosts, point out-of-the-art studios with various camera angles, and one of many market’s speediest streaming systems. All of these make for a unique casino environment that immerses gamers on several units.Undoubtedly my preferred social Casino web-site! Actual Prize is my initially head to da